An administrator to do what exactly? This is the OpenOffice (volunteer)
support group. That's as official as it gets. The software is free; so
is the support. The volunteer support group is run by people around the
world working in our spare time for no pay.
I'm fairly confident that if you clearly explain your problem and give
proper details of things like the exact version you are using, the OS
and version you are using etc. that we will be able to help. Please
don't send attachments; most get stripped anyway. Be aware that this is
a mail list; your message will be seen by hundreds of people.
OpenOffice software is free to download and use on as many computers as
you like in any context you like - business, personal, educational, etc.
Check (or have your lawyer check) the licence details at
http://www.openoffice.org/license.html
If you want paid support, you can buy StarOffice from Sun. Or you can
pay Sun "by the drink" for support of the free software; see
http://www.sun.com/service/serviceplans/software/openoffice/index.xml
for details.
